    I received a quote from a few plumbing companies in ******** ** ****, one of which came from Mr Rooter. The original quote was for ******** received on ******** *** ****. The original quote included changing out shower/tub faucet handles and pop up stopper, two grab rails in shower and installing a new shower head rail. Mr Rooter was advised in early ******* **** to go ahead and do the work. They came shortly after that and installed the two handrails and the shower head rail. During this visit we asked them about a couple sink issues as well. There was an issue with the sink pop up stopper and that it was not draining properly. It was determined that they had installed the shower head rail approx 10” to low. They returned a few days later and moved the shower head up approx 10”. The resulting holes are still there. We were advised that the handles were on order and they would return in a couple of days to finish the job. During this visit they installed a new drain pop up connector (the original faucets remained this was just the pop up drain connector) and they also installed a P trap under the sink. They issued a new quote to cover this work on ******* *** **** and an additional one on ******* *** ****. The total on these quote came to ******* and ******* respectively. (The total on the 3 quotes would now be ********. On ******* *** **** they issued an overall quote for all above work for a total of ******** (I believe the difference of ******* was due to a seniors discount and advantage plan discount that was applied). I was asked by Mr Rooter to pay this amount at this time even though only a portion of the work had been completed which I did. They advised me at this time that they were still waiting for parts to finish the remaining work. I was advised it would be just a couple of days. I called them the following week and they said they were still waiting for parts. See attached photos and related paperwork.

    Business Response

    Date: 21/06/2023

    The original quote ******** ** *** ******** was for the following:
    ·      Change out handles on shower (was not repaired due to the fact of age and risk of causing more damage) – REFUNDED ******* ·      Install Pop Up on shower (upon further inspection during the job was not repaired due to the fact the overflow and p-trap needed to be replaced which a new estimate was created) – INCLUDED IN REFUND OF *******
    ·      Install grab rails in the shower – COMPLETED
    ·      Install sliding shower head w/rail – COMPLETED

    During the visit to complete the work we were asked to move the shower rail higher as requested. Due to the request of moving the shower head would require new holes to be made in the tile. Silicone was used to seal the holes at the time.

    SIGNED OFF & COMPLETED – ******* ** - Quote was quested for ********
    ·      Auger the bathroom sink drain
    ·      Pop-up for the bathroom sink

    DECLINED BY CUSTOMER - ******* ** - Quote was made for remodelling the shower handles and faucets including the rough in for ********.

    SINED OFF & COMPLETED – ******* ** - Quote for Re-piping under the bathroom sink to bring the plumbing up to code FOR *******

    DECLINED BY CUSTOMER – ******* ** - Quote for the shower/tub overflow replacement for $********

    The job was completed over the course of 2 days. Originally called out ******** **** to estimate the work requested by the client. First day worked was Friday ******* **th, parts were needed to complete the job, so we had to make a return trip Tuesday ******* **st to complete.

    All our customers are required to sign off on the invoice once the work was completed and then we collect payment. This is required for all customers that do not have an account set up.

    All signed off and agreed upon work was completed. The work that the client is claiming to be incomplete is the estimates that was declined and not approved by the customer.
